Because we’re a person-to-person organization, we focus on the specific needs of each individual, respect their journey and keep the focus on their potential.
Our focus will always be more on someone’s potential rather than their past.
We’re part of a broader, National Urban League network of 98 historic civil rights organizations throughout the United States—all dedicated to fostering economic empowerment in order to elevate the standard of living in historically underserved urban communities. The Urban League does not discriminate based on race or ethnicity, religion or sexual orientation.
